仅仅应用于单页应用的滑动操作,用swiper4.x接管页面的滚动操作。用来支持顶部和尾部的回弹效果,进一步来支持常见那种下拉刷新动画效果。不适用于轮播图那种应用场景。 虽然只是针对swiper4.x,但相关原理,在别的...
滑动效果比较好,还有优化的,怎么预加载,怎么放置3个Video组件进行预加载的问题。 平移画,模拟上下滚动的效果。大体思路是固定的一个视频组件,把封面图平铺在视频组件上,根据手势滑动的范围,确定上滑或倾斜,...
开源、免费、强大的触摸滑动插件 swiper使用 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=...
用Uniapp写的App端swiper滑动模块,主要是理解原理,如果后期有可能的话再优化成组件。本篇文章主要参考卧龙派的文章手把手教你用原生js来写一个swiper滑块插件(上)原理,感谢分享。 参考文章 手把手教你用原生js...
github地址:react-swiper NPM安装: npm install react-swiper-lite 1.工作原理 通过touchstart,touchmove和touchend实现拖动监听: touchstart记录第一次触摸点位置; touchmove记录当前移动到的位置并更新元素...
标签: 移动开发
## 1.1 什么是Swiper滑动轮播组件 Swiper是一个现代而强大的移动端触摸滑动插件,用于网站和APP的触摸滑动支持。它能够无缝地支持触摸滑动、鼠标拖动、切换效果、无限循环、分页器等功能,是移动端界面开发中常用的...
前言 一般而言,swiper的应用场景...近期接到一个h5项目,主体头部是一个选项卡,对应两个子页面,每个子页面的第一屏为一个满屏的kv,监测到向下滑动时平滑过渡到第二屏,而第二屏是一个长页面。 思路 ...
它的作用是提供一种系统性的方法,以有效地应对挑战、优化流程或实现目标。以下是方案的主要作用: 问题解决: 方案的核心目标是解决问题。通过系统性的规划和执行,方案能够分析问题的根本原因,提供可行的解决...
swiper组件卡顿,swiper内嵌套包含视频video组件太卡不流畅,uniapp swiper里面有视频播放太卡怎么办,uniapp swiper里面包含视频没播放完就自动划走了,swiper里面的视频如何播放时禁止自动轮播滑动,在uniapp中...
保证swiper-item的数量固定,加载大量数据时,大大优化渲染效率 记录上次的位置,页面初次加载不一定非得是第一页,可以是任何页 答题卡选择某一index回来以后的数据替换,并去掉swiper切换动画,提升交互体验 ...
关于滑动翻页,有很多优秀的插件可以使用,但是多多少少都有点大,所以自己试着完成一个组件来实现。(以左右滑动翻页为例) 1、主要思路 最主要的就是对三个触摸事件的处理:touchstart、touchmove、touchend ...
Swiper Swiper是一个滑块容器类组件,主要提供如下的一些属性。 属性名 类型 说明 支持版本 indicator-dots Boolean 是否显示面板指示点...
标签: vue
uni-app判断左右滑动组件优化 <template> <view @touchstart="touchStart" @touchend="touchEnd" > <slot></slot> </view> </template> <script> export default ...
使用Swiper做一个周日历功能,要求滑动swiper时,可以显示上一周/下一周的日期...看到这篇文章《小程序 - swiper滑动日历》,受到了启发,于是继续尝试,这次总算是成功了。 思路 使用数组存放3个周的日期,weeks = ...
import Taro, { Component } from '@tarojs...import {View, Text,ScrollView, Image,Swiper,SwiperItem} from '@tarojs/components' import { fromJS, is ,List} from 'immutable' import {throttle} from "...
对于 Swiper 组件滑动过快造成卡顿的问题,可以尝试以下几种解决方法: 1. 减少渲染内容:如果在滑动过程中需要渲染大量的内容,可以考虑减少渲染的元素数量,或者使用虚拟滚动技术来优化性能。 2. 图片优化:如果...
如果在支付宝小程序使用 `swiper` 组件横向滑动时,出现高度不生效的情况,可以尝试以下优化代码: ```html <view class="swiper-wrap"> <swiper class="swiper" indicator-dots="{{false}}" vertical="{{false}}...
因项目开发中很多都有用到轮播图的地方,然后选择用了swiper,记录一下,之前一直没有发布这个文章,现在官方好像已经优化了这个问题。因为this.mySwiper中没有值导致的,需要进行swiper初始化一下。问题描述:在...
3. 虚拟列表:将 swiper 组件中的图片使用虚拟列表技术进行优化,只渲染当前可见区域的图片。 4. 使用 CSS3 动画:尽量使用 CSS3 动画代替 JS 动画,减少 JS 计算对性能的影响。 5. 减少运算量:减少在滑动过程中...
记录下笔记,大神勿喷,可以留下优化建议,谢谢最近刚刚做了个展示型的网站,使用swiper搭的框架,因为图片比较多,所 以首次加载稍微有些慢,虽然压缩过了,但是尽可能的优化吧,刚开始找了个懒加载的一个插件,但...
swiper和tabs切换优化 这里我用到了uview的组件 官网:https://www.uviewui.com/components/intro.html 具体实现就是你首次切换时把数据存在一个对象中,对象里有多个数组,每个数组对应切换的数据, tabs组件 tabs...
最近在做一个测试题,前后可以切换题目,点击按钮选择答案,选择答案的同时改变按钮的背景色,如下图所示:初始代码我用了vue和swiper。所有的题目是一个对象数组,通过v-for渲染:- 第{{ index+1 }}题 -{{ item....
优化的点: 1、改变组件结构,滑动组件的宽度由100vw改为自定义 SwiperPage.vue &lt;template&gt; &lt;div class="ths_swiper-page"&gt; &lt;t-swiper-wrap&gt; &lt;t...